The Tanzania Vehicle Intelligence Systems market is experiencing steady growth driven by increasing awareness of road safety, government regulations mandating the use of safety technologies, and the rising demand for connected vehicles. Key players are focusing on developing advanced driver assistance systems, telematics, and vehicle tracking solutions to cater to the evolving needs of consumers and fleet operators. The market is characterized by the presence of both local and international vendors offering a wide range of products and services. With the adoption of technologies like GPS tracking, collision avoidance systems, and vehicle diagnostics, the Tanzania Vehicle Intelligence Systems market is poised for further expansion as stakeholders strive to enhance road safety, reduce accidents, and improve overall transportation efficiency.

In the Tanzania Vehicle Intelligence Systems Market, key challenges include limited awareness and understanding of the benefits of such systems among vehicle owners and operators, leading to slow adoption rates. Additionally, the high initial costs associated with implementing advanced vehicle intelligence systems pose a significant barrier for many potential users, especially in a market where cost considerations heavily influence purchasing decisions. The lack of standardized regulations and policies related to vehicle intelligence systems also hinders widespread adoption and integration across the country. Furthermore, issues related to data privacy and security concerns present additional challenges for companies looking to introduce these technologies in Tanzania. Overcoming these obstacles will require targeted education campaigns, strategic pricing models, regulatory support, and robust cybersecurity measures to drive the growth of the Vehicle Intelligence Systems Market in Tanzania.

The Tanzania government has implemented various policies to regulate and promote the Vehicle Intelligence Systems (VIS) market in the country. These policies focus on enhancing road safety, reducing vehicle theft, and improving transportation efficiency. The government has mandated the installation of tracking devices in all vehicles to monitor their movements and curb unauthorized use. Additionally, there are regulations in place to ensure that VIS providers comply with industry standards and data protection laws. The government also offers incentives to encourage the adoption of VIS technology, such as tax breaks and subsidies for installing tracking systems. Overall, these policies aim to create a safer and more efficient transportation system in Tanzania through the widespread use of Vehicle Intelligence Systems.
